Black History 5K Run
MWR Fitness will host the annual Black History 5K Run, Feb. 27 at 9 a.m. at the Bay Room, Greenbury Point, NSA Annapolis. The run is open to all active duty, retired military, active reservists, DoD civilian employees, family members, USNA contractors, Midshipmen and guests. Active duty can participate for free; all others including family members are $5⁄person. For more information, call Tony Compton, MWR Fitness Director, at 410-293-9211
Child Development Center Hourly Care
Hourly care is open to children, ages 6 weeks to 5 years old at the Child Development Center, NSA Annapolis. Reservations can be made up to 30 days in advance and no more than 25 hours per week are permitted for hourly care. Individual Augmentee spouses are eligible for free care by registering with the Fleet and Family Support Center at 410-293-2641. All military and DoD civilian families are eligible. Contact the CDC at 410-293-9390 for more information and costs.

Oil Disposal Station
The oil disposal station at the Navy Exchange Gas Station, Naval Support Activity Annapolis is temporarily unavailable due to the construction of the new MWR Car Wash in that location. The oil disposal station will be relocated in the gas station compound with expected completion in February 2010. A county waste management facility can be used in the interim. For locations in the county, please call Anne Arundel County Waste Management at 410-222-6100. The nearest disposal station to NSA Annapolis is the Millersville Landfill & Resource Recovery Facility, 389 Burns Crossing Road, Severn, Md.; open Monday - Saturday, 8 a.m. to 4 p.m.; closed all holidays.
